Latest Patents

One of Ping Dong's latest patents is titled "Device and method for achieving rotational invariance in a multi-level." This invention provides a parity check that utilizes a nonlinear dependence upon bits other than the parity bit alone. The device and method allow for the detection of errors in a first rotationally-significant label bit, achieving a rotationally transparent parity check. Another significant patent is "Error check code recomputation method time independent of message length." This method enables the recomputation of a new error-check code for altered messages in a data packet communications network, ensuring computational time remains independent of the message length while preserving the integrity of the initially computed error-check code.
